BASIC PICTURES REQUIRED (but more may be requested): If necessary pictures are in the listing, it's not necessary to upload and duplicate them.
  • Front of item
  • Back of item
  • Full clear and legible creed text and serial number
  • Made in tags (when available)
  • Measurements
  • For bags with turnlock closures, show pictures of back of female side of turnlock
  • For bags with magnetic snaps, show pictures of the male part of the snap so that the numbers and letters on it can be read
  • If applicable, search interior of bag and/or pockets for small white tag with production information and include a picture of that.

Both are genuine.

The light colored one looks like a Compartment Bag, style 9850. It was introduced in 1989 but I don't know exactly when it was discontinued. Without being able to see the format of the serial number, all I can say is that it was probably made between 1989 and maybe 1994.

The black City Bag was made in 1998.
